How specific approaches translate to online therapy

CBT helps people notice and change unhelpful thoughts and behaviors. Online sessions use discussion and short exercises to test new ways of thinking, which can help with anxiety, depression, and stress-related problems.

The Gottman Method focuses on improving communication and reducing conflict in close relationships. Through guided conversations and practical communication skills taught in sessions, people can practice new interaction habits and handle relationship challenges more effectively.

Motivational Interviewing is a collaborative way to build motivation for change. It uses open questions and reflective listening to help someone clarify goals, reduce ambivalence, and take small steps toward healthier choices.
